  • Lot# : 8052 New Guinea

    Third Watermark (Type 6) of Australia, perf. 12 1915 (Dec) / 1916 (Aug): 3 d. yellow-olive, Dies I and II, an unused sheet / pane of 30 subjects, Fourth Setting, Left Pane, lower half, of fresh colour showing seven pairs with Die and Die II se-tenant, together wikth "Circle Stops" after "W" on positions 36 and 48 and "Circle Stops" after "S" on positions 42 and 48, flaw on position 55, very fine but for sixth stamp with rounded corner, couple of tone spots on gum and small part of pink rice paper backing on one stamp, large part or unmounted og. Rare Gi = £ 2'500++.rnrnProvenance: 'Dr. Gyp', Adriano Landini, Milan, 14 Nov 1992, lot 2208.rnrnThe Se-tenant Die I / Die II pairs are vertical positions 31/37, 32/38, 39/45, 40/46, 41/47, and horizontally 51-52, 59-60.
